3. Succulent patio table arrangement

How would you like to create a centerpiece that stays beautiful all summer long with almost no maintenance? Succulents are the perfect choice for outdoor tables because they thrive in the heat and come in a stunning variety of shapes and colors. You can arrange different sizes of echeveria and jade in a shallow stone trough to create a modern, desert-inspired look. Surround the plants with smooth river rocks or fine sand to give the display a finished, professional appearance. This low-profile design is excellent for conversation since it does not block the view of guests sitting across from one another in the garden environment.

6. Outdoor floating candle centerpiece

What is the best way to add a touch of romance and magic to your patio after the sun goes down? A wide glass bowl filled with water and flickering floating candles creates a stunning shimmering effect that reflects the moonlight beautifully. You can add a few blossoms like gardenias or rose petals to the water for extra color and a light, floral fragrance. This centerpiece provides a soft, ambient glow that is much more intimate than harsh overhead lighting. It is a simple yet sophisticated DIY project that makes any summer evening feel like a special occasion worth celebrating with your loved ones.

10. Outdoor lantern table lighting

Can you imagine a more inviting scene than a patio table glowing with the soft light of several classic lanterns? Lanterns are a staple of summer decor because they protect candles from the breeze while adding a structural, architectural element to the table. You can find them in various materials like matte black metal, polished brass, or weathered wood to match your existing patio furniture. Grouping three lanterns of different heights creates visual interest and ensures that the light is distributed evenly across the dining surface. They provide a safe and stylish way to keep the party going long after the evening shadows arrive.

18. Lavender patio table styling

Could there be anything more relaxing than the sight and scent of fresh lavender while you dine outdoors? Using bundles of dried or fresh lavender as part of your table decor brings a touch of the French countryside to your backyard. You can place small sprigs on each napkin or fill a tall ceramic pitcher with a large bouquet for a simple, stunning centerpiece. The soft purple hue of the lavender pairs beautifully with grey linens and weathered wood furniture. It also has the added benefit of naturally repelling some insects, making your outdoor dining experience much more comfortable and pleasant for everyone.
